Arłamów — a ski slope in the Przemyśl Foothills

The slope at Arłamów belongs to the hotel and sits about 100 m from its entrance: four easy runs totalling roughly 1.5 km, snowed and floodlit, served by two platter lifts and a magic carpet for children.

Arłamów — runs, lifts and facilities

Arłamów lies in the Bieszczady district, in the Ustrzyki Dolne commune, where the Przemyśl Foothills meet the Słonne Mountains. The place has an unusual history: a government retreat built in the 1970s, where Lech Wałęsa was interned in 1982, it is today a large hotel with its own sports facilities. The ski slope is part of that complex and stands about 100 metres from the main building.

The scale is modest. The operator lists four runs totalling over 1.5 km — the longest is around 550 m, and the largest vertical is about 90 m, with the hilltop at roughly 590 m above sea level. They are served by two platter lifts of 400 and 500 m plus a magic carpet for the youngest skiers. Every run has snowmaking, floodlighting and regular grooming.

In practice this is a slope for learning and relaxed skiing rather than serious training. Its biggest asset is the absence of crowds: Arłamów sits deep in the forests of the Carpathian wilderness, far from other settlements, so lift queues are rare even during school holidays. Anyone after longer descents will find them at the slopes around Ustrzyki Dolne in the same region.

Who the slope suits

This is a slope for beginners, children and anyone returning to skiing after a break. The runs are short, wide and gentle — the most demanding drops about 90 m over 500 metres, which with good grooming makes for calm, predictable conditions in which to learn to turn. Children start on the carpet and move on to the shorter platter lift. Intermediates can get solid technique practice and dozens of repetitions a day, but advanced skiers will leave unsatisfied: there are no red or black runs, no snowpark and no descent long enough to build real speed. Arłamów is a place for a family stay rather than a dedicated ski trip.

Getting there

The address is Arłamów 1 in the Ustrzyki Dolne commune, about 35 km from Przemyśl. From Warsaw it is roughly 435 km, about 5 hours: the S17 and S19 via Lublin towards Rzeszów, then the A4 eastwards, leaving near Przemyśl and continuing on local roads via Krasiczyn or Kalwaria Pacławska. From Rzeszów it is about 125 km, from Kraków about 280 km.

The final stretch is a winding forest road climbing uphill and needs care in winter — with snow on the ground, winter tyres are essential and a first visit is best not attempted after dark. There is parking at the hotel and the slope is about 100 metres away, so the car stays put once you arrive. Public transport barely reaches the area; the nearest railway stations are Przemyśl and Ustrzyki Dolne.

Season and slope conditions

The season at Arłamów is shorter than in the higher mountains and depends heavily on the weather — the resort quotes mid-December to mid-March as a guide, and in 2024/2025 the slope operated from 28 December to 9 March, 67 days in total. The runs face south-west and get a lot of sun, so in milder spells snowmaking and overnight top-ups do the heavy lifting. Floodlighting genuinely extends the skiing day in midwinter. Check the resort’s current status before travelling, as opening dates shift from year to year.

What else is nearby

Arłamów sits on the boundary between the Słonne Mountains Landscape Park and the Przemyśl Foothills Landscape Park, surrounded by Carpathian forest. Within about an hour’s drive are Ustrzyki Dolne, Lake Solina with its dam and the Bieszczady National Park; to the north lie Przemyśl with its old town and fortress works, the castle at Krasiczyn and the monastery at Kalwaria Pacławska. The region is part of a dark-sky reserve, so clear winter nights offer unusually good stargazing.

Frequently asked questions

Where is the Arłamów ski station?
In Subcarpathian Province, in the Ustrzyki Dolne commune, where the Przemyśl Foothills meet the Słonne Mountains. The address is Arłamów 1, about 35 km from Przemyśl and 125 km from Rzeszów. The slope belongs to the local hotel and lies about 100 m from its entrance.
How many runs and lifts does Arłamów have?
Four runs totalling more than 1.5 km, all easy. They are served by two platter lifts of 400 and 500 m plus a magic carpet for children. The longest descent is around 550 m.
Is Arłamów suitable for beginners?
Yes, that is its main purpose. The runs are short, wide and gentle, there is a ski school and a rental shop, and children start on the magic carpet. The lack of crowds means learning tends to progress faster than on busy slopes.
Is the slope snowed and floodlit?
Yes. All runs have technical snowmaking and floodlighting and are groomed regularly. That matters here, because the slope faces south-west and catches a lot of sun.
How long is the season at Arłamów?
Roughly mid-December to mid-March, though the dates depend on the weather — in 2024/2025 the slope ran from 28 December to 9 March. Check the resort’s current status before setting out.
How do I get to Arłamów from Warsaw?
About 435 km, roughly 5 hours by car: the S17 and S19 via Lublin towards Rzeszów, then the A4 eastwards, leaving near Przemyśl and finishing on local roads via Krasiczyn or Kalwaria Pacławska. The last stretch is winding and wooded, so take care in winter.
Is there anything here for advanced skiers?
Not much. Every run is easy, the vertical tops out at around 90 m, and there is no snowpark and no red or black terrain. Advanced skiers tend to treat Arłamów as an add-on to a stay rather than the reason for the trip.
What else is there to do nearby?
Within about an hour you can reach Ustrzyki Dolne, Lake Solina with its dam and the Bieszczady National Park, while to the north lie Przemyśl with its old town and forts, Krasiczyn castle and Kalwaria Pacławska. The area belongs to a dark-sky region, so winter nights are good for stargazing.
